Where to stay in Cambridge

Find the best Cambridge areas and neighborhoods for the activities you enjoy most.

Central Square

Central Square pulses with multicultural energy between Harvard and MIT. Students mix with locals in quirky bookstores and international eateries serving everything from Ethiopian to Korean cuisine. Vibrant street art splashes across brick buildings while live music spills from indie venues. The Red Line subway station connects you easily to Boston's heart and famous universities. Magazine Beach along the Charles River offers a green escape from urban bustle. This walkable neighborhood blends academic charm with authentic cultural experiences in a way few American neighborhoods can match.

Kendall Square

At the heart of Boston's innovation ecosystem, Kendall Square buzzes with tech energy and academic brilliance. MIT's iconic dome watches over glass towers where startups and tech giants like Google and Microsoft thrive. Students dash between labs while professionals grab coffee from food trucks serving global cuisine. Wide sidewalks and bike lanes make exploring easy, with the Red Line subway connecting you directly to downtown Boston. Visit the MIT Museum to discover groundbreaking inventions or stroll along the Charles River just minutes away. The neighborhood quiets down evenings and weekends when the tech crowd disperses.

Porter Square

Located around Massachusetts Avenue and Somerville Avenue, this area boasts the Porter Square Shopping Center and Galleria, as well as Susumu Shingu's 46-foot kinetic sculpture, Gift of the Wind. Enjoy Japanese eateries and easy access to the MBTA Red Line and Commuter Rail Fitchburg Line.

MIT

The MIT neighborhood in Cambridge showcases one of the world's premier academic institutions. Wander through the campus where classical limestone buildings contrast with avant-garde structures like the twisted metal Stata Center. The area attracts a diverse international community of scholars and curious visitors alike. Explore the MIT Museum's cutting-edge robotics and holography exhibits or relax on Killian Court's manicured lawns facing the Charles River. The Red Line subway at Kendall/MIT station provides direct access to Boston. Food trucks and casual cafeterias serve international favorites, making this intellectual hub both fascinating and accessible.

East Cambridge

East Cambridge blends riverside charm with innovative energy, all just minutes from downtown Boston. Stroll along the Charles River for stunning skyline views or explore the MIT Museum's interactive science exhibits. The neighborhood's red brick industrial buildings contrast beautifully with modern glass structures. The vibrant CambridgeSide Galleria offers excellent shopping options when you need retail therapy. Converted warehouses now house creative spaces and innovation labs, giving the area its intellectual atmosphere. From Vietnamese pho shops to upscale farm-to-table restaurants, diverse dining options satisfy every craving.

A museum corridor with taxidermy animals, including a large elephant statue.

Harvard Museum of Natural History

9.0/10 (199 reviews)
Marvel at the world-famous Glass Flowers collection—over 4,000 botanical models crafted entirely from glass. Explore the Great Mammal Hall where six whales hang suspended from the ceiling alongside giraffes and zebras.

Best time to go to Cambridge

The best time to visit Cambridge can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Cambridge falls in July, when vis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Cambridge falls in January, visitor numbers are slightly low and weather is mostly sunny with light r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January28.8°F (-1.8°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ly Low
February30.0°F (-1.1°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low
March36.9°F (2.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
April47.8°F (8.8°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ighAverage
May58.5°F (14.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
June66.6°F (19.2°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
July73.6°F (23.1°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ighAverage
August72.5°F (22.5°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
September65.5°F (18.6°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
October54.9°F (12.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
November43.5°F (6.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
December35.1°F (1.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ly Low

What's the seasonal weather like in Cambridge?
The hottest months are usually July and August with an average temp of 70°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 33°F. Average annual precipitation for Cambridge is 47 inches.
